Former Bulldog Battery CFO faces felony charges tied to racketeering $150,000
Thomas A. Wagner
 
By Emma Rausch
 
A former Bulldog Battery company official is facing nine felony charges for allegedly taking approximately $150,000 from the company.
 
Thomas A. Wagner, 59, Wabash, was placed into the Wabash County Jail Monday, Nov. 7, for charges including three felony counts of theft, two counts insurance fraud, two counts conspiracy to commit insurance fraud and two counts corrupt business influence.
 
Wagner acted as the company’s chief financial officer (CFO) before he was “let go” in June, according to the Wabash Police Department’s probable cause affidavit.

Veterans honored with ‘Quilts of Valor’
More than 50 veterans were honored Wednesday, Nov. 9, by the Quilts of Valor quilters during the annual Veterans Luncheon. Photo by Emma Rausch
 
By Emma Rausch
 
A dozen Wabash County women honored more than 50 veterans at the fourth annual Quilts of Valor presentation Wednesday afternoon, Nov. 9.
 
In conjunction with the Women’s Clubhouse, the Quilts of Valor quilters hosted a free veteran’s luncheon to honor Wabash County’s past servicemen.
 
The group began several years ago during a lunch discussion for a yearly service project, according to Lois Vanmeter, quilter spokeswoman.

Hundreds gather to honor veterans
Students from the Wabash Middle School fill Hill Street in front of the Wabash County Courthouse. Photos by Joseph Slacian
 
By Joseph Slacian
 
Students from the Wabash Middle School were among the more than 300 people in attendance at the Wabash County Veterans Day ceremony at the Wabash County Courthouse.
 
Those attending heard comments from the commanders of the Wabash American Legion and VFW posts, as well as remarks from Mayor Scott Long, and letters from Sen. Joe Donnelly and U.S. Rep. Jackie Walorski.
 
Long, a U.S. Army veteran, spoke about how Veterans Day came about. It was created at 11 a.m. on the eleventh day of the eleventh month, when Germany signed the treaty ending World War I.

WCS Board formally accepts MSD invitation
By Emma Rausch
 
Wabash City Schools and MSD of Wabash County boards of education will meet in joint executive session in the near future to discuss the future of the two school systems.
 
In September, the MSD Board invited the Wabash and Manchester Community Schools boards to the tri-partite executive session to discuss topics including declining enrollment, feasibility studies and consolidation.
 
Wabash City Schools Board of Education formally announced its acceptance to the MSD of Wabash County discussions invitation Monday night, Nov. 7.

Commissioners looking to reduce spending on CodeRED system
By David Fenker
 
The contract for Wabash County’s emergency alert notification system is up for renewal, and the County Commissioners are looking to improve its terms and save money.
 
Keith Walters, County Emergency Management Agency executive director, informed the commissioners that the county’s contract for the CodeRED Alerting System is up for renewal, at the price of $28,500 for the next three years. The system is a telephone-based emergency alerting system that warns county residents of emergency situations via text message or TDD/TTY for the hearing impaired. The county’s contract includes 50,000 minutes per year, which are used up as alerts go out.
 
County Attorney Steve Downs had reviewed the contract, and posed a question to the commissioners that may result in a reduced price.

Work underway on Rock City Lofts
By Joseph Slacian
 
After nearly two years, work has started on one of the Stellar Grant programs major projects.
 
Work began in mid-October on the Rock City Lofts, a downtown apartment complex for those 55-years and older. It is in the building that now houses the Rock City Café on East Market Street.
 
Mayor Scott Long said crews began demolition work at the site after financing for the project was finalized. That was good news for the mayor.
